matrix-react-sdk
Populate the file panel using the event index if available.
#3858
Merged

Populate the file panel using the event index if available. #3858

poljar merged 23 commits into develop from poljar/seshat-filepanel
poljar
poljar FilePanel: Refactor out the file panel and convert the methods to asy…
d30c46a6
poljar EventIndex: Live events can be unencrypted as well.
4f63b104
poljar BaseEventIndexManager: Add a method to load file events of a room.
263370c9
poljar EventIndex: Add a method to populate an event timeline with file events.
8a17c73b
poljar FilePanel: Use the event index in encrypted rooms to populate the panel.
a1cbff3c
poljar LifeCycle: Start the event index before the client.
7fb3645e
poljar FilePanel: Implement pagination requesting using the EventIndex.
49c1dbe4
poljar EventIndex: Update the imports for the new build system.
70d394e6
poljar BaseEventIndexManager: Update the docs for the loadFileEvents method.
95b86b42
poljar FilePanel/EventIndex: Fix lint errors.
ccfe3c7e
poljar poljar requested a review 6 years ago
turt2live
turt2live requested changes on 2020-01-17
poljar Lifecycle: Comment why we need to initialize the index before the cli…
9978fee5
poljar FilePanel: Remove a stale comment.
0c854fce
poljar EventIndex: Don't import the whole js-sdk.
b4c8a686
poljar EventIndex: Simplify the json event getting logic.
0b4b9d8d
poljar EventIndex/FilePanel: Allow longer lines.
4cf44cf5
poljar EventIndex: Use the newly exposed TimelineWindow methods.
a0599ded
poljar
poljar poljar requested a review 6 years ago
jryans jryans requested a review from turt2live turt2live 6 years ago
jryans jryans removed review request 6 years ago
poljar EventIndex: Correctly populate events on initial fill requests.
735ba4fd
poljar FilePanel: Listen for live events and add them to an open FilePanel.
f917c2fa
poljar FilePanel: Don't import the whole of the js-sdk.
c5e8753b
poljar FilePanel: Remove whitespace before two function definitions.
c3418df9
poljar
turt2live
turt2live approved these changes on 2020-01-24
poljar EventIndex: Fix a small style issue.
ecfecfe5
poljar
poljar FilePanel: Add comments to explain what's going on with the event index.
3534cd42
poljar EventIndex: Add docstrings for the FilePanel methods.
37f289b1
poljar poljar merged 37f289b1 into develop 6 years ago
poljar poljar deleted the poljar/seshat-filepanel branch 5 years ago

Login to write a write a comment.

Login via GitHub

Reviewers
Assignees
No one assigned
Labels
Milestone